Not too excited to write about this wine. Maybe it was the the fact I opened it up in 103 heat, however I did give it a quick chill before corking. Overall my impressions were that of an ordinary Zinfandel---it never coaxed me to believe that these vines were over 100 years old. The traditional jammy characteristics of so many other California Zins barely came through on the palette with this 2007 Sausal Century Vines. Sorry to say but it tasted more like a watered down Merlot to me. I wish I would have purchased a second bottle from the winery when I visited back in 2010 so I could open it up under more "normal circumstances". Oh well.
